πŸ” Key Features Breakdown

  • Social Activity Synchronization: Automatically shares daily online metrics with a curated list of friends or family members, creating a system of soft accountability that encourages healthier habits through visibility.
  • Real-Time Comparative Statistics: Offers immediate insights into who is currently active and for how long, allowing users to benchmark their behavior against their peer group in real-time.
  • Digital Break Support: Facilitates communal "offline" periods, where users can motivate one another to stay away from screens, solving the problem of FOMO (Fear Of Missing Out) during downtime.
  • Smart Goal Notifications: Empowers users to set personal limits and receive intelligent alerts when they approach their thresholds, preventing mindless scrolling before it becomes a multi-hour habit.

βš–οΈ Pros & Cons Analysis

  • βœ… The Good: Innovative use of social benchmarking to drive positive behavior changes rather than relying on punitive restrictions.
  • βœ… The Good: Robust privacy architecture that ensures personal data is only shared with explicitly approved contacts.
  • ❌ The Bad: The real-time tracking element may lead some users to check the app too frequently, potentially counteracting the goal of reduced screen time.
  • ❌ The Bad: The effectiveness of the platform is highly dependent on the activity level and honesty of the user's social circle.
